Section 249 Permit from local inspector of buildings

Section 249. No person shall install sheet metal work without first obtaining a permit from the local inspector of buildings or other official. The permit shall be obtained by mailing or delivering a permit application form approved by the board to the inspector or other official. A person failing to obtain the permit shall be punished by a fine to be determined by the board. This section shall be enforced by inspectors of buildings or other officials designated by the local building authority and the board. Nothing in this section shall affect, restrict, diminish or limit any other penalty or remedy provided by law, nor shall any enforcement action taken by a local inspector or other official limit the board from taking any action within the scope of its jurisdiction.
